Course Home | Assignments | Computing Resources | Lab Hours/Tutoring | Questionnaire | Schedule | Submit

Saint Louis University

Computer Science 146
Object-Oriented Practicum

Michael Goldwasser

Fall 2013

Dept. of Math & Computer Science


SCHEDULE

Please note that the schedule for future classes is tentative.

Meeting Topic References
August 27 Introduction to object-oriented programming,
marine biology case study
pp. 6-12 of case study
September 3 work on asgn01,
Septemeber 10 Defining classes in C++,
AquaFish class, asgn02
pp. 13-18 of case study
(aquafish source code)
September 17 Intro. to Case Study Part II pp. 19-28 of case study
September 24 in-class work on asgn03
October 1 The Environment and Simulation classes;
data representation with vectors and matrices
pp. 29-35 (and top of 36)
October 8 The Fish class
UML Diagrams
pp. 36-42
October 15 work on asgn05/asgn06
October 22 No Class - Fall Break
October 29 discussion of asgn06
November 5 Coping with interdependent definitions in C++
Advanced Declarations
discussion of asgn07
November 12 Discussion of asgn08
November 19 Continued work on asgn08
November 26 Inheritance Hierarchies
(discussion of asgn09)
December 3 work on asgn09


Michael Goldwasser
CSCI 146, Fall 2013
Last modified: Monday, 11 November 2013
Course Home | Assignments | Computing Resources | Lab Hours/Tutoring | Questionnaire | Schedule | Submit